How Does the Sudden Shock Cancellation System Actually Work?
The disruptions behind Sudden Shock: Frontier Cancels Palm Springs Flights—Heres the Hidden Truth! stem from operational pressures commonly faced by regional carriers. When staff shortages—especially pilots and flight attendants—intersect with strict regulatory requirements and tight scheduling windows, even minor setbacks can cascade into widespread cancellations. Unlike major airlines with larger reserves, regional operators like Frontier face acute sensitivity to scheduling lulls. Advanced forecasting tools now track these vulnerabilities, but sudden staff absences or weather-related delays often trigger cascading failures. The term “sudden shock” captures this domino effect—where small operational cracks collapse into visible service breaks, reshaping how travelers plan and expect consistency.

Navigating these cancellations raises many practical concerns. Readers frequently search: How frequently does Frontier cancel flights unexpectedly? Can passengers recover time or rebook easily? What compensation or alternatives are offered after a sudden shock?
To clarify: While Sudden Shock: Frontier Cancels Palm Springs Flights—Heres the Hidden Truth! highlights operational breakdowns, airlines are required to rebook affected travelers promptly, often with priority based on booking class. Most cancellations due to staffing shortfalls allow free rebooking within 24–48 hours. Compensation varies but may include reimbursement or special arrangements depending on delay length. Passengers also receive real-time updates via app alerts and official communications, helping mitigate confusion. The core takeaway: While disruptions are rising, established rebooking protocols protect customer continuity.

A common myth is that flight cancellations are random or avoidable. In truth, most shutdowns at Frontier and similar carriers result from systemic workforce and scheduling challenges—not negligence. Another misconception is that affected passengers receive no support; in reality, regulatory frameworks and airline policies ensure rebooking and timely communication. The “sudden shock” label reflects the abrupt nature of these events, not recklessness behind them. Transparency in reporting these root causes builds trust and informs more responsible travel planning.
